As the Deputy is aware the South Eastern Health Board has responsibility for the provision of health services in the Waterford area. The board has a number of priorities for 2000 in relation to the provision of services for older people in Waterford in accordance with the board's policy document Towards the Golden Years – 1998-2011. These include the following: the continued upgrading of St. Joseph's Hospital, Dungarvan, through the commissioning of St. Enda's ward; the completion of the refurbishment of St. Malachy's ward in St. Patrick's Hospital, in conjunction with the ‘Friends of St. Patrick's. I have allocated the board additional funding of approximately £600,000 in 2000 to provide additional services for older people including day care and respite care and home support services. This funding will also be used to strengthen multidisciplinary teams through the appointment of additional posts of occupational therapists and speech and language therapists.
